Simple to chic


Where: Taking Hunter to school

Don’t you just have those days where you are just DYING to lie around in your pajama’s and do nothing?  Seriously it’s like me everyday.  But then you realize that you have someplace to go.  I implore you fashion mama’s…DO NOT go out in those pajamas.  I just think we are all SO MUCH BETTER than that, right?  So here’s just a little “what I did” to show you how simple it can be to run a quick errand NOT in your sweats.  This is not a tutorial, as half the time I have no idea what I’m doing while I’m doing it.  HA! 
Anyway…so South Jersey went from the mid 60’s in temperature to the low 30’s in a DAY.  If you think I was excited to get out of bed to dress for the cold weather…you’d be so, so wrong.  So very wrong.  So I threw on my most comfortable jeans and loungy sweatshirt and favorite argyle socks.
DSC_0833
Yes I cut my head off.  My Dad is sending me his tripod as we speak. Anyway…so..not so fashionable right?  Nothing wrong with it, but definitely screams “lazy mom who likes to lounge in pajamas.” And being that I had to take Hunter to school that morning, I didn’t want to portray that to the other moms…although that describes me to a tee.  So this is what I did
DSC_0836
Black Sweatshirt: Gap body
Jeans: Old Navy
Socks: Target
Boots: Macy's (I don't know the brand, sorry)
Inifiti scarf: F21
Jacket: Old Navy

How simple? How cute?  All I did was throw on a pair of flat, slouchy suede boots, a toggle jacket with a sweet plaid print, and a knit infinity scarf.  I even let my sweatshirt peek out for a bit of butt coverage and a nice layered look.  Ladies…it’s just that easy.
A few things.  First…I love Uggs, and many women wear then well, but to just get an inexpensive pair of boots that are Ugg-like in comfort but have a little sass to them…super easy!  My tip is to get them at Macy’s in the off season…maybe March/April.  They were CHEEEAAAPPP. These were about $10, got them off season with a coupon, and they are thick, and lined and I got them in April.  Even though it seemed ridiculous because I couldn’t wear them right away…I stored them and the next year it was like opening presents.  NEW SHOES!  Also, infinity scarfs are on trend, stylish, and totally the busy moms best friend.  You don’t even have to take the time to wrap it around…and if your 3 year old has to go to the bathroom in an emergency, you don’t have to worry about your scarf ends falling into the toilet.  It’s only happened once…but once is enough.  And lastly, the jacket.  Most of the time when you’re running errands…NOBODY SEES YOUR CLOTHES.  So get a cute patterned jacket with great details!  It’s all people are going to see!  It’s a game changer.  This one? $21 at Old Navy after sale plus coupon.  Done.
